Transaction 6c5bebec0dc144d5313c14b8452695c5872369afdfde23c9ad44a5116d4ed701
1 Input
1 Outputs
- 6c5bebec0dc144d5313c14b8452695c5872369afdfde23c9ad44a5116d4ed701:0
value 891068
address 1ExKedcgcXQ7FmDgpBfvMGedeKJKgQAYCX